What is Model Context Protocol Server for DeepSeek?

The DeepSeek MCP Server provides a robust framework for integrating DeepSeek's innovative language models into various applications. It supports natural language commands for model management, configuration adjustments, and conversation control. By offering automatic model fallback, resource discovery, and multi-turn conversation support, it enhances user interaction and customization. The server is designed for easy installation via Smithery or manual setup, and can be used with tools like MCP Inspector for testing and debugging. Its primary use cases include deploying high-performance reasoning models, training conversational datasets, and managing complex dialogue flows in production environments.
